VIDEO: Woman Burned in Wilson Farm Road Fire

The woman was found on the front lawn Sunday night suffering from burns.

A woman was hospitalized with burns Sunday after escaping a fire at her Wilson Farm Road home.

Westford firefighters responded to the home at about 10:30 p.m. after receiving a call someone may be trapped inside.

First responders found the woman on the front lawn suffering from burns, according to the fire department. She was transported to UMass Memorial Medical Center in Worcester. Her name was not released.

A second-floor bedroom received the bulk of the fire damage. Fire crews had the fire under control within an hour and a half, according to Fire Chief Richard Rochon.

The cause of the blaze was unclear. It is being investigated by Westford fire officials and the State Fire Marshal's Office.

Fire crews from Acton, Chelmsford, and Littleton aided Westford firefighters at the scene.
